Bookkeeper: Cost of hiring?
- Common salary in AU: $72,186 yearly
- Typical salaries range from $54,206 – $96,131 yearly
*Indeed data (AU)

What's the average time to fill a bookkeeper role?
The average time to fill a bookkeeper role is 39 days, calculated from the moment the job is posted until a candidate accepts the offer.
What skills do bookkeepers tend to have?
According to the candidates available on Smart Sourcing, the most common skills for a bookkeeper include: xero, microsoft office and accounts receivable.
What licenses or certifications are common for a bookkeeper?
Common licenses or certifications for bookkeepers include: Xero, Working with Children Check and Certificate IV.
What are some job titles related to bookkeepers?
According to Indeed’s Smart Sourcing data, job titles related to bookkeepers include: BOOKKEEPER AND VIRTUAL ASSISTANT, senior bookkeeper and accounts officer/bookkeeper.
What level of education is common for a bookkeeper?
Bachelor's degree is the most common level of education for a bookkeeper in Australia, according to available candidates on Smart Sourcing.
How many years of experience is common for a bookkeeper?
Most bookkeepers have 11 years of professional experience.
